ALEXANDRIA, Va., July 23 -- United States Patent no. 12,366,357, issued on July 22, was assigned to Rheem Manufacturing Co. (Atlanta).
"Fuel/air mixture and combustion apparatus and associated methods for use in a fuel-fired heating apparatus" was invented by Amin Akbarimonfared (Fort Smith, Ark.), Timothy J. Shellenberger (Tyronne, Ga.), Robert Steven Neihouse (Fort Smith, Ark.), Scott Alan Willbanks (Fort Smith, Ark.), Darryl Farley (Fort Smith, Ark.), Nathan Taylor Whalen (Alma, Ark.) and Shawn Allan Reed (Charleston, Ark.).
